debian

Debian SecureCRT的性能优化技巧

小樊
45
2025-07-03 19:57:05
栏目: 智能运维

在Debian系统上使用SecureCRT时,可以通过以下几种方法来优化性能:

  1. 调整网络设置

    • 确保系统网络配置正确。Debian系统使用/etc/network/interfaces文件来配置网络接口,可以根据实际需求调整网络参数,比如调整TCP/IP参数以适应网络环境。
  2. 启用TCP快捷连接 (TCP Fast Open)

    • 在Debian系统上,可以通过修改/etc/sysctl.conf文件来启用TCP快捷连接。添加或修改以下行:
      net.ipv4.tcp_fastopen = 3
      
    • 然后运行以下命令使更改生效:
      sudo sysctl -p
      
  3. 调整SSH配置

    • 编辑/etc/ssh/sshd_config文件,优化SSH服务器的设置。例如,可以调整以下参数:
      ClientAliveInterval 60
      ClientAliveCountMax 5
      
    • 这些设置可以减少连接空闲时间,保持连接活跃。
  4. 使用压缩

    • 在SecureCRT中,启用SSH压缩可以显著提高传输效率。在SecureCRT的会话设置中,找到“Connection” -> “SSH” -> “Compression”,选择“Enable compression”并选择合适的压缩算法。
  5. 调整终端类型

    • 确保SecureCRT中的终端类型与Debian系统设置的终端类型一致。可以在SecureCRT的会话设置中选择正确的终端类型(如Xterm或VT100)。
  6. 禁用不必要的协议

    • 在SecureCRT的会话设置中,禁用不必要的协议(如SSH 2的加密认证),以减少连接建立的延迟。
  7. 使用本地代理

    • 如果可能,使用本地代理(如mitmproxy或Charles)来缓存和压缩数据,减少传输的数据量。
  8. 升级SecureCRT

    • 确保使用的是最新版本的SecureCRT,新版本通常包含性能改进和bug修复。
  9. 优化系统资源管理

    • 关闭不必要的服务。在Debian系统上,可以通过系统监视工具(如htop或systemctl命令)来监控和管理系统资源,关闭不必要的服务以释放更多的CPU和内存资源供SecureCRT使用。
  10. 调整内核参数

    • 通过编辑/etc/sysctl.conf文件,可以调整内核参数,如net.core.somaxconnnet.ipv4.tcp_tw_reuse,以优化网络连接性能。
  11. 调整SecureCRT界面设置

    • 在SecureCRT中,可以调整会话设置,如减少显示的字符集和字体大小,以减少CPU和内存的使用。
  12. 使用会话复用

    • SecureCRT支持会话复用功能,可以在多个会话之间共享连接设置和本地环境变量,从而减少每次连接时的配置时间。
  13. 硬件优化

    • 确保网络硬件(如网卡、路由器)性能足够,避免网络瓶颈影响SecureCRT的连接速度。

通过以上方法,可以在Debian系统上优化SecureCRT的性能,提高远程连接的效率和稳定性。在进行任何系统配置更改时,请确保了解相关操作的影响,并在测试环境中进行验证。

0
看了该问题的人还看了